Do I have a blown head gasket?
Hi, I have a grand cherokee zj 1993 4.0L inline 6 and a few days ago it overheated. Turned out to be a stuck thermostat. We changed it and started the engine and it runned well. I need some opinions trying to know if the HG blew since I have no leaks, no oil in the coolant or coolant in the oil, it does not overheat (reaches the normal operating temperature and doesn’t go higher than that) the only thing is that sometimes there’s a little bubble of air in the water reservoir, but maybe it’s normal since the system is still getting water everywhere. What are your thoughts on this?

Update:
Guess my bad luck got the better of me, turns out after some little use of the car to transport some debris in a trailer we needed to rev the engine a bit to get out of the mud. After that when the engine was hot it was difficult to make it start again. We decided to check the water reservoir and there was just a bit of water left and then we checked the engine oil and what was our surprise when we saw that magical milk oil.
Guess after all the engine wasn’t good.
My father is not happy at all of course since here these cars aren’t really cheap and used so the engine replacement shouldn’t be too cheap. Do you guys know more less the price of replacing or repairing the engine? Thanks
